Detection of Clonally Restricted Immunoglobulin Heavy Chain Gene Rearrangements in Normal and Lesional Skin: Analysis of the B Cell Component of the Skin-Associated Lymphoid Tissue and Implications for the Molecular Diagnosis of Cutaneous B Cell Lymphomas
A monoclonal B cell population is the hallmark of B cell neoplasms including cutaneous B cell lymphomas (CBCLs). We modified and tested several polymerase chain reaction (PCR)-based assays involving amplification of immunoglobulin heavy chain (IgH) gene rearrangements to optimize assays specifically...
